    Which of the following equation is non-linear

    A)                 \[\frac{dy}{dx}+\frac{y}{x}=\log x\]

    B)                 \[y\frac{dy}{dx}+4x=0\]

    C)                 \[dx+dy=0\]         

    D)                 \[\frac{dy}{dx}=\cos x\]

    Correct Answer: B

    Solution :

                       A differential equation in which the dependent variable and its differential coefficient occur only in the first degree and are not multiplied together is called a linear differential equation.                                 Hence \[y\frac{dy}{dx}+4x=0\]is non-linear differential equation.
